본문 바로가기

분류 전체보기

[Git] Eclipse와 Git 연동하기 Step 1. 기존에 Eclipse에 있는 프로젝트를 로컬 Repository를 만들어 연동하기 1. Eclipse에서 연동하려는 프로젝트 우클릭 > Team > Share Project ... 2. Configure Git Repository 창이 켜지면 클릭 3. Git 저장소의 경로를 지정하는 단계입니다. 보통 사용자₩사용자이름₩git 으로 경로가 되어 있습니다. (Mac 기준으로는 아래 캡처와 같이 repository 폴더가 새로 지정되어 있을 겁니다.) 이때 이 Git 저장소의 경로가 이클립스의 프로젝트 폴더의 경로와 달라야 합니다. 저는 뒤에 새로 지정할 로컬저장소명을 붙여주었습니다. Finish를 눌러줍니다. 저장소 위치, 작업 위치 등 저장소와 관련된 기본 설정을 볼 수 있습니다. Curr.. 더보기
[Java] BufferedInputStream 와 BufferedReader 프로그램의 실행 성능은 입출력이 가장 늦은 장치를 따라간다. CPU와 메모리가 아무리 뛰어나도 하드 디스크의 입출력이 늦어지면 프로그램의 실행 성능은 하드 디스크의 처리 속도에 맞춰진다. 네트워크로 데이터를 전송할 때도 마찬가지다. 느린 네트워크 환경이라면 컴퓨터 사양이 아무리 좋아도 메신저와 게임의 속도는 느릴 수밖에 없다. 이 문제에 대한 완전한 해결책은 될 수 없지만, 프로그램이 입출력 소스와 직접 작업하지 않고 중간에 메모리 버퍼(buffer)와 작업함으로써 실행 성능을 향상시킬 수 있다. 예를 들어 프로그램은 직접 하드 디스크에 데이터를 보내지 않고 메모리 버퍼에 데이터를 보냄으로써 쓰기 속도가 향상된다. 버퍼는 데이터가 쌓이기를 기다렸다가 꽉 차게 되면 데이터를 한꺼번에 하드디스크로 보냄으로써.. 더보기
[Bootstrap4 사용법] justify-content 속성 그림으로 보는게 가장 빠르니 아래 그림을 참조하자. 아무것도 지정해주지 않는다면 default 속성은 justify-content-start 이다. between과 around의 차이점 around는 자신의 블록 기준으로 왼쪽, 오른쪽의 공백크기가 같다. (그래서 맨처음과 맨 끝이 채워져 있지 않다. 공백이 들어가기 때문.) between은 맨처음과 맨끝에도 채워져 있다. 더보기
[Bootstrap4 사용법] display 사용하기 1. div 를 inline 처럼 사용하기 (d-inline 클래스) 2. div 를 inline-block 으로 사용하기 (d-inline-block 클래스) ※ inline 과 inline-block 과의 차이점 윈도우 사이즈를 최대화 했을 때 (1792x919) 윈도우 사이즈를 줄였을 때 (929x919) 일정 breakpoint 를 지나면 d-inline-block 이 적용된 div의 경우 아래 row로 분리됨 윈도우 사이즈를 더 줄이면? d-inline 은 마치 문단마냥 자연스럽게 아래로 이어지지만, d-inline-block 은 하나의 div끼리 딱딱 분리됨 더보기
[Bootstrap4 사용법] Grid 사용하기 1. 똑같은 너비의 컬럼들 만들기 (Equal-Width Columns) 부트스트랩에서는 row와 col을 이용해서 그리드를 만든다. 똑같은 너비의 Columns 를 만들어보자 다음과 같은 row와 col 조합은 반응형 웹에서 어떤 size에 있어도 모양을 유지한다. Bootstrap에서 mx-0 는 negative margin을 없애주는 클래스이다. (-15px, -15px -> 이런식으로 margin 들어가있는 경우를 없애줌)\ 2. 한쪽만 긴 컬럼 만들기 (One Wider Column) 3. margin, padding 전부 없애기 (No Gutters) * no-gutters 를 적용하지 않았을 때 위의 진회색 박스와 비교해보면, negative margin 과 약간의 padding이 들어가 있.. 더보기
[Mac 기초] Spotlight 사용하기 Spotlight는 원하는 폴더/파일에 빠르게 접근 가능하다는 것도 있지만 아래와 같이 은근 유용한 기능들이 있다. 기본 단축키는 option + 스페이스바 계산기도 바로 사용 가능 85kg이 몇파운드인지 $56달러가 현재 환율로 얼마인지 더보기
[Mac 기초] Tag 사용법 Tag 사용법 색깔별로 태그를 지정함으로써 원하는 폴더나 파일을 빠르게 접근 가능 폴더 오른쪽 클릭을 하면 태그 색깔을 지정할 수 있습니다. 참고로 아이콘 우클릭 하는거랑 설정 버튼 누르는거랑 똑같은 기능이예요 문서 폴더에서 다음과 같이 어떠한 기준으로 빨강, 노랑, 초록 태그를 지정해줬습니다. 왼쪽 사이드바에서 원하는 색깔 태그를 클릭하면 빠르게 access 가능합니다. 은근 유용해요. 더보기
[CSS] display 속성 display 속성을 알아보기 이전에, div 태그와 span 태그를 알아봅시다. div block 형식으로 공간을 분할합니다. span inline 형식으로 공간을 분할합니다. div 를 쓰는 경우 span을 쓰는 경우 display 속성은 태그가 화면에 보이는 방식을 지정하는 속성입니다. none 태그를 화면에서 보이지 않게 만듬 block (= flex) 태그를 block 형식으로 지정함 inline (= inline flex) 태그를 inline 형식으로 지정함 inline-block 태그를 inline-block 형식으로 지정함 div 태그에다가 block 형식을 지정 했을 때 div 태그에다가 inline 형식 혹은 inline-block 형식을 지정 했을 때 더보기